Police probe viral video of student stoned at school games

The Ghana Police Service has opened a formal investigation into a viral video showing a student being pelted with stones by a mob of other students.

In a statement issued on Monday, February 23, the police said they had seen the footage and condemned the violence.

“The Ghana Police Service has sighted a viral video in which a group of people are seen pelting stones at a student. Investigations into the incident are ongoing, and further developments will be communicated in due course,” the statement said.

“The Service strongly condemns the violence and assures the public that all perpetrators will be identified and brought to justice,” it added.

Information from the Central Region indicates that the incident occurred on Thursday, February 19, during a district school's athletics competition in Agona Swedru.

The event, meant to promote youth talent and sportsmanship, turned violent following a confrontation between students of Awutu Obrachire Senior High Technical School and those believed to be from Swedru School of Business.

The victim, a student of Obrachire Senior High Technical School, was attacked with stones and sticks. He was taken to a health facility, where he is receiving treatment. Reports indicate he remains in a critical condition.

Videos of the incident circulated widely on social media platforms over the weekend, showing the student being attacked before some bystanders intervened. The footage has drawn condemnation, with calls for action from law enforcement and education authorities.
